 To be successful in the role, TSA’s must maintain and build a strong client focus, and awareness and understanding of the bank and operational aspects of the products and services used by clients in addition to possessing good interpersonal, communication and presentation skills.

•              Support the Treasury Sales Officer (TSO) in exceeding portfolio growth goals; including client/prospect research; proposal development, and other ad hoc sales support duties

•              Assist in identifying solutions to client needs as requested or as a result of needs analysis

•              Schedule and perform client portfolio reviews, and upsell Treasury products and services as needed

•              Produce pricing/cost benefit models and confer with the TSO and Management regarding non-standard pricing and negotiation

•              Manage the sales pipeline; ensuring deals are properly identified as pending or closed

•              Accountable for accuracy of sales data within source systems (e.g. Deal Pipeline, client plans, call reports, GPS-MIS, Navigator, etc.), and other sales tracking systems which may be developed

•              Resolve any non-sales client issues

•              Assist clients in navigating the bank by liaising with the Client Service, Fulfillment, Credit and other partner teams

•              Prepare account schematics, proposal documents and sales presentations

•              Partner with Fulfillment team to ensure timely delivery of Treasury Solutions to our clients and post-sale satisfaction

•              Assist in coordinating the Client Management Process (CMP), by focusing on client acquisition and deepening existing relationships through identification of client needs

•              Utilize support partners and resources to coordinate industry, prospect, and client research for use in pre-call planning

•              Daily email, phone and in-person client communication

Required Qualifications:

  • Two or more years of experience in Financial Services or the Treasury Group of a company, proven excellent verbal and written communication skills, proven organizational and time management skills.

  • Demonstrated ability to analyze issues and develop solutions ,experience working in a fast-paced environment as part of a larger team, proven experience developing rapport with clients, colleagues and other business partners.

  • Excellent MS Office (Word/Excel/PowerPoint/Outlook) experience.       

Desired Qualifications:

  • Preferred candidates will have a Bachelor's degree, cash management experience,  their CTP (Certified Treasury Professional) and have proven experience prospecting and developing new business
